Canadian indie-punks Fist City have unleashed the official video for ‘The End Of Good Times’. Following an appearance at Brighton’s Great Escape Festival in May, the quartet will return to the UK in October and November, as well as releasing a double A-side completed by ‘Let’s Rip’, on the 13th November.
The tracks appear on their recent ‘Everything Is A Mess’ full-length, available via Transgressive Records.
“While ‘Let’s Rip’ is a tune about finding your partner in crime; the kind of partner in crime that gives you stick and poke tattoos and tries to fight you in an alley sometimes, ‘End Of The Good Times’ is about smashing your car into a wall in the middle of the night, throwing the keys into a gutter and leaving the steaming pile of shit behind,” explains guitarist Evan Van Reekum. “I guess it’s about getting older.”
